What is a Contract RPG Programmer?

A Contract RPG Programmer is a software developer who is hired on a temporary or project basis to work with RPG (Report Program Generator) programming, typically on IBM i (AS/400) systems. They are responsible for designing, coding, maintaining, and troubleshooting applications written in the RPG language. Contract RPG Programmers often work with businesses that need short-term support for legacy systems, upgrades, or specific projects, rather than hiring a full-time employee. Their expertise is valuable for companies looking to maintain or enhance their IBM i environments efficiently.

What are some common challenges faced by contract RPG programmers when working with new clients or legacy codebases?

Contract RPG programmers often encounter challenges such as quickly adapting to unfamiliar legacy code, understanding existing business logic, and integrating new features without disrupting current systems. Communication with clients to clarify requirements and expectations is also key, as documentation can sometimes be limited or outdated. Building rapport with in-house teams and effectively managing project timelines are essential skills to ensure smooth collaboration and project success.

What Does a Contract RPG Programmer Do?

Report Program Generator (RPG) is a proprietary programming language from IBM for developing business applications. A contract RPG programmer creates and customizes applications for businesses and writes codes using the RPG language on a contract basis, either for short-term or long-term projects. As a contract RPG programmer, your job duties include determining what your client needs and expects from the application, testing new or existing code to meet those expectations, and debugging applications before configuring them for use on a company’s computer network. You also suggest development strategies for new applications and train staff on how to use the new software and applications when necessary.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Contract RPG Programmer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Contract RPG Programmer, you need strong expertise in IBM RPG programming languages (including RPG IV and free-format RPG), experience with IBM iSeries (AS/400) environments, and a background in software development. Familiarity with tools like Rational Developer for i, SQL, CL programming, and source control systems is typically required. Excellent problem-solving, communication, and time management skills help contract programmers effectively interact with clients and deliver projects on tight deadlines. These skills ensure reliable, efficient development of business applications and successful collaboration in dynamic project-based settings.
